Single vehicle fatal collision

Columbia Valley

2024-07-11 08:33 PDT

On July 9, 2024, at approximately 10:30 p.m., Columbia Valley RCMP responded to a report of a single vehicle motor vehicle collision on Westside Road, near Panorama Drive, in Wilmer, BC.

Upon arrival, first responders located a vehicle which had driven off the highway, and down an embankment.

The driver was taken to hospital with what’s believed to be serious, non-life-threatening injuries, while three passengers were sadly pronounced deceased, confirmed Cpl. James Grandy, BC RCMP spokesperson. Speed, along with intoxication, are both believed to be a contributing factor.

The collision knocked out power lines, which led to a power interruption to the community.

RCMP offers their condolences to the families affected in this tragic incident.

Columbia Valley RCMP, along with assistance from a BC Highway Patrol Collision Reconstructionist, and the BC Coroners Service, are investigating.
